Kimberly Shonta Willis, Beloved Sister, Mother, and Healthcare Advocate, Passes Away at 49, Leaving Family and Community in Mourning
Kimberly Shonta Willis passed away on April 11, 2026, at the age of 49, leaving her family and community in profound sorrow.
Known for her immense compassion and dedication, Kimberly devoted her life to caring for others through her work in healthcare, touching countless lives along the way.
She was deeply cherished by her husband, Billy, and her three children, who were the center of her world. Her family remembers her as a loving, selfless, and nurturing presence who prioritized others above all else.
Kimberly's generosity continued even in her passing, as she was an organ donor, extending her gift of life to help others.
Friends and supporters expressed heartfelt condolences online, reflecting the deep impact she had on everyone around her. Melissa Marino, who organized a fundraiser for Kimberly’s family, wrote, "Our hearts are completely broken. Kim had the biggest heart and loved her family fiercely."
A GoFundMe campaign has been created to assist with funeral arrangements and to support her children during this difficult time. Memorial service details will be announced by the family as they prepare to honor Kimberly’s legacy.
Her warmth, dedication, and unwavering love leave a lasting mark on all who knew her.
